Friends of the Library will elect officers Nov. 3
Friends of the Bluffton Public Library will meet Wednesday, Nov. 3. According to Friends president Jan Potter, the meeting will be held at 4:30 p.m. in the library's Richland Room. Officers will be elected for 2011 and finances for 2010 will be reviewed.
The organization will also discuss accomplishments from the past year and begin to coordinate volunteer activities planned for the upcoming year.
Some examples include the annual membership drive, a formal tea with Abe and Mary Todd Lincoln, spring and fall book sales, the Community Garage Sale, and a golf scramble.
The meeting is open to the public. Potter said, "This is an excellent opportunity to learn more about the Friends of the Library. You may have never heard of the Friends or maybe you have paid your dues but have yet to attend a meeting. You will see how rewarding it can be to get more involved."
The Friends of the Bluffton Public Library encourage everyone who uses the library to make a donation and to share their time, energy, and ideas. You can join the Friends by making an annual donation of $5 or more.
